In today’s episode, I review the neuroscience behind the Connectome. Using material presented in Brain Facts published by the Society for Neuroscience, I talk about how our neurons communicate with one another, and how our brain is able to encode information to interpret, process, and respond to the different stimuli in our environment. Ep. 0: Introduction to the Brain Bee Podcast
Welcome to the Brain Bee Podcast! The Brain Bee Podcast will feature a short lecture from the material presented in Brain Facts published by the Society for Neuroscience, followed by a conversation with an expert on said topic. In today’s episode get to know host Ankit Choudhury, why he created the podcast, and what you can come to expect with each episode.
